  Enhance Your Sleep Naturally What you eat in the hours before bed shapes how well you sleep — and how rested you feel when you wake up. These everyday foods are quietly working in your favor, if you let them.   You've probably tried all the usual sleep advice — no screens before bed, keep your room cool, stick to a schedule. And that stuff genuinely matters. But there's a piece of the sleep puzzle that doesn't get nearly enough attention: what's on your plate. The food you eat directly influences your body's ability to produce melatonin, regulate serotonin, and maintain the magnesium levels that allow your muscles and nervous system to relax. Poor sleep and poor diet are so tightly linked that researchers now study them together — and the findings make a compelling case for a more intentional approach to evening eating. The good news? Dinner That Heals & Energizes — A Nourishing Way to End Your Day



There’s something powerful about ending your day with food that doesn’t just fill you, but heals you. This healthy dinner brings together fresh salmon, steamed vegetables, and quinoa — a perfect balance of protein, fiber, and healthy fats.


Eating this kind of meal regularly helps your body recover from daily stress, supports heart health, and boosts your energy for the next day. Instead of heavy, greasy meals that leave you tired, this dinner leaves you feeling light, strong, and satisfied.


You don’t need expensive ingredients or complicated recipes to nourish your body. Just natural, colorful foods cooked with love and intention.
